BREAKING: Alec Baldwin and His Brother Crash SUV Into Tree in the Hamptons

by October 13, 2025
October 13, 2025

Alec Baldwin and his brother Stephen Baldwin crashed an SUV into a tree in East Hampton, New York, on Monday.

It is unclear who was driving the vehicle at the time of the crash.

TMZ obtained photos of the crash.

TMZ reported:

Alec Baldwin can’t seem to catch a break … because he was just involved in a vehicle crash in The Hamptons, TMZ has learned.

The Oscar-winning actor and his brother Stephen got into an accident in East Hampton, New York, on Monday when they barreled head-first into a tree as they drove in their Range Rover.

It’s clear from the footage — the entire front end of the SUV is totaled. What’s not clear is who was driving and who owns the Range Rover. We’ve reached out to East Hampton PD for information … so far no word back. We’ve also reached out to reps for Alec and Stephen … but all we’ve heard is crickets.

As you know, it’s been a rough few years for Alec, beginning with the 2021 “Rust” film set tragedy in which Baldwin was accused of fatally shooting Cinematographer Halyna Hutchins. Alec was later acquitted of manslaughter at his criminal trial and cleared of any wrongdoing.

Alec Baldwin has been in legal trouble for the last several years and he just can’t catch a break.

Alec Baldwin was previously indicted by a grand jury on charges of involuntary manslaughter in the fatal ‘Rust’ shooting.

Baldwin was charged with two counts of involuntary manslaughter for the shooting death of Halyna Hutchins.

In July 2024, a judge dismissed all charges against Alec Baldwin after his defense team alleged government misconduct.

Baldwin shot and killed 42-year-old Halyna Hutchins and injured 48-year-old Joel Souza on the movie set of ‘Rust’ in Santa Fe, New Mexico in October 2021.

Alec Baldwin’s defense team accused state prosecutors of concealing evidence. In a stunning move, the judge dismissed the charges in the middle of the trial.
